Key ceremony checklist — item 4: nightly backfill scheduler

Release manager, this one's yours. Confirm the Dovetail scheduler at Kernwright Analytics has its backfill window frozen during the ceremony — we don't want nightly jobs grabbing the signing service mid-rotation. Pause the queue, verify no backfills are in-flight on the Marrow dashboard, and note the pause time in the ceremony log. After the new keys are cut, re-enabling the scheduler's encrypted job store will ask for the recovery passphrase.

unlock words, tawif-tahop: oliys-ulawyn-tamdor-lamys-casox-jormir-fraius-kasath-ulador-ulamir-holir-sorys-holeth

Runbook 7.1 — Payslips for the Gorsebridge depot. Gorsebridge still has no working printer (don't ask), so payslips get printed at head office, sealed in the brown wage envelopes, and sent out each payday via Redfen Dispatch. Keep them in the locked cabinet until the rider shows up — no leaving them at the front desk. One envelope per person, counted before sealing the pouch. Release the pouch only against this pass-phrase:

courier memo of yawep-yafog: the pramir ulaix courier leaves the ulavan aldix frair zorok oliiel joreth rusdor fenvan ledger at gate 1305 under passcode 514738

# Break-Glass: Catalog Cache Invalidation

Scope: the Pinrow product catalog at Veldstone Retail. If stale prices persist after a purge and the Hollowmere invalidation queue is wedged, use break-glass to flush the edge tier directly. Contractors: get verbal sign-off from the catalog lead first. Steps: open the Hollowmere admin shell, select emergency-flush, confirm the tenant, and run it once — repeated flushes thrash the origin. Access is logged and expires after 20 minutes. Unseal the admin shell with the passphrase below.

recovery phrase for kahop-tajog: istix-casvan

Break-glass: Ledgerline migrations. Zero-downtime schema changes on Ledgerline normally go through the Fernholt pipeline with dual review. If the pipeline is down and a migration must ship, use break-glass: confirm the expand/contract pattern, get one verbal reviewer ack, and log the change in the incident channel. The break-glass migration runner unlocks with the passphrase below.

unlock words, hahap-yawig: pelix-kelion-tamys-jorix-julok